For an extra boost, add a tablespoon of chia seeds or flaxseed meal for added fiber and omega-3 fatty acids. If you prefer a colder smoothie, use frozen strawberries instead of fresh. Adjust the amount of honey to your desired sweetness. Feel free to experiment with other berries, such as blueberries or blackberries, for a unique flavor twist.
